  • Metastores #

    A metastore is a database used to catalog the metadata of a data collection. Metastores map files in distributed objects store systems such as S3 and HDFS into tables, and provide metadata such as columns names and type mapping. Metastores also provide data to the cost-based optimizer.

    Before you can query data in an object storage account, it is necessary to have a metastore service associated with that object storage.

    Starburst Galaxy metastore #

    Starburst Galaxy provides its own metastore service for your convenience, which you can use alongside Amazon S3, Azure Data Lake Storage, and Google Cloud Storage catalogs. You do not need to configure and manage a separate Hive Metastore Service deployment or equivalent system. Note that this is a Galaxy-specific feature, and is not the same as the Starburst Metastore supported by SEP.

    In Metastore configuration, select Starburst Galaxy to set up and use the built-in metastore provided by Galaxy.

    For Amazon S3 and Google Cloud Storage, create a bucket in your object storage account, and create a directory in that bucket. Provide that bucket name and directory name. This location is then used to store the metastore data associated with this S3 or GCS account.

    For Azure ADLS, create a container in your storage account, and create a directory in that container. Provide this storage container name and directory name. This sets up the location used to store the metadata associated with this storage account.

    The meanings of the two Allow controls are the same for a Starburst Galaxy metastore as for a separate Hive Metastore Service, described below.

    Note that deletion of the catalog also results in removal of the associated Starburst Galaxy metastore data.

    AWS Glue #

    When using Galaxy’s S3 catalog only, you can select AWS Glue to manage the metadata for your object storage. Configure access to AWS Glue with the following parameters:

    • AWS Glue region
    • Access security with AWS access key for Glue and AWS secret key for Glue or Cross account IAM role

    Hive Metastore Service #

    You can use a Hive Metastore Service (HMS) to manage the metadata for your object storage. The HMS must be located in the same cloud provider and region as the object storage itself.

    A connection to the HMS can be established directly, if the Starburst Galaxy IP range/CIDR is allowed to connect.

    If the HMS is only accessible inside the virtual private cloud (VPC) of the cloud provider, you can use an SSH tunnel with a bastion host in the VPC.

    In both cases, configure access with the following parameters:

    • Hive Metastore host: the fully qualified domain name of the HMS server.
    • Hive Metastore port: the port used by the HMS, typically 9083.
    • Allow creating external tables: switch to indicate whether new tables can be created in the object storage and HMS from Starburst Galaxy with CREATE TABLE or CREATE TABLE AS commands.
    • Allow writing to external tables: switch to indicate whether data management write operations are permitted.

    Metastore or API catalogs #

    Some Galaxy catalogs connect directly to specific metastores or APIs instead of to object storage catalogs. These metastores are presumed to be configured to support one or more existing object storage tables.

    • Unity Use Galaxy’s Unity catalog to connect to managed or external tables on AWS, Azure, or Google Cloud.

    • Polaris Use Galaxy’s Apache Polaris catalog to connect to Iceberg tables through the Iceberg REST API on AWS S3 or Google Cloud.

    • S3 Tables Use Galaxy’s Amazon S3 Tables catalog to connect to Iceberg tables in an AWS table bucket through the Iceberg REST API on AWS S3. S3 Tables are presumed to be configured to use AWS Glue as to manage metadata.

    • Lakekeeper Use Galaxy’s Lakekeeper catalog to connect to Iceberg tables on Azure Data Lake Storage through Lakekeeper.
